Tyttenhanger Green is in Tyttenhanger, St. Albans and in St Albans district. AL4 0RN is located in the Colney Heath elect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of St Albans.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Tyttenhanger Green was 39.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 51.7% lower than the Colney Heath average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Tyttenhanger Green has the 6th lowest crime rate of 18 local areas in Colney Heath and the 185th lowest crime rate of 430 local areas in St Albans .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 11.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-73.4%.
